A freeze warning has been issued from early Wednesday morning through Friday morning with widespread sub-freeze temperatures expected across the interior portions of the Bay Area and Central Coast, according to the National Weather Service.
The coldest morning is likely to be on Thursday with the coldest interior spots dropping into the mid 20s.
Sensitive plants and crops may damaged or killed in these conditions.
Be sure to properly shelter pets and livestock in warm and dry places.
Outdoor plumbing and irrigation may become damaged if not prepared for these freezing conditions.
